Address

NcPApVDSrubWmvqQgHUfRxv2p9qQLzZyts

12013796.29786475 XNA

Confirmed
Total Received12013796.29786475 XNA
Total Sent0 XNA
Final Balance12013796.29786475 XNA
No. Transactions319

Transactions

 
NcPApVDSrubWmvqQgHUfRxv2p9qQLzZyts2703.76040000 XNA×
 
NcPApVDSrubWmvqQgHUfRxv2p9qQLzZyts1703.22470000 XNA×
 
 
NcPApVDSrubWmvqQgHUfRxv2p9qQLzZyts38301.99759407 XNA×